About The Team

The RPS Asset, Surveying, and Inspection (AS&I) team provides industry-leading services to the UK Water Industry and our employees are involved in services supporting Water Networks, Drainage, Surveying, Leakage Consultancy, Water Resources and Efficiency. The team analyse complex data and provide pragmatic solutions, including reducing water leakage and preventing flooding and pollution in local communities. Our team assess, diagnose, and determine the most appropriate solution to reduce leakage and support the delivery of regulatory targets with accuracy that delivers a great service for clients.

Your Responsibilities

* Assist in delivering leakage reduction by using your expertise to resolve complex operational issues, including detecting proactive and reactive leaks on our clients’ network using a combination of methods
* Assess, diagnose, and determine the most appropriate solution to reduce leakage and support the delivery of regulatory targets
* Maintain Health and Safety standards
* Achieve KPI targets and deliver leakage detection/reduction within DMAs
* Attend excavations requested by R&M to assist leak location
* Train and mentor assistant leakage technicians
* Assume responsibility for general admin tasks (electronic timesheets submissions, weekly vehicle checks, defect reporting)
* Form and maintain excellent working relationships with colleagues, contractors, and the client


Skills, Knowledge, And Experience

* Any prior experience in a similar role is useful; we will train you in water network hydraulics, leakage detection techniques, monitoring/reporting of leakage levels and other issues in the clean water industry
* Willingness to learn utility tracing, noise logging, and step-testing planning/operation to build experience in leakage monitoring, pressure/flow, and data capture techniques

Health And Safety

* Moving heavy items including inspection chamber covers
* Working in all weather conditions (may include night work)
* May be required to work in confined spaces and on highways
* Mandatory drugs and alcohol tests and a DBS check where applicable
